2. Canva

Canva is often the first tool creators turn to, and for good reason. It has established itself as an incredibly accessible, beginner-friendly design platform with a dedicated YouTube Thumbnail Maker that simplifies the entire process. Its massive library of templates means you never have to start from a blank canvas, making it one of the best thumbnail makers for YouTube if you need to produce content quickly and consistently.

The platform excels at providing a balanced, all-in-one experience. The drag-and-drop editor is intuitive, allowing non-designers to combine text, graphics, and their own images effortlessly. You can upload a high-quality headshot and easily place it into a professionally designed layout. For creators who need a consistent look, having professional headshots on hand is crucial; using an AI tool can help you generate a variety of options without a photoshoot. You can learn more about creating AI headshots from a single photo to streamline your branding assets.

Key Features & Pricing

  • Massive Template Library: Thousands of pre-made, fully customizable YouTube thumbnail templates for every niche.
  • Brand Kits: (Pro feature) Store your channel's logos, fonts, and color palettes for one-click branding.
  • Collaboration: Invite team members to edit and comment on designs in real-time.
  • Stock Assets: Access to a vast library of free and premium photos, icons, and video clips.

Pricing: Canva offers a robust free plan. Canva Pro starts at $14.99/month for one person, unlocking premium templates, a background remover, Brand Kits, and more.

Feature Free Plan Canva Pro Plan
Templates 250,000+ free templates 610,000+ premium & free templates
Stock Photos 1+ million free photos & graphics 100+ million premium stock assets
Brand Kit Limited (one color palette) Multiple brand kits
Background Remover No Yes (one-click)

Pros:

  • Extremely intuitive and easy for beginners.
  • Huge ecosystem of templates and assets.
  • Excellent for team collaboration and maintaining brand consistency.

Cons:

  • Best features (like Background Remover and Brand Kits) are behind a paywall.
  • Templates can sometimes feel generic if not heavily customized.

10. Kapwing

Kapwing positions itself as a collaborative online editor for modern creators, and its YouTube Thumbnail Maker is a direct extension of that philosophy. It's particularly powerful for creators whose thumbnail concepts are born directly from their video content. The platform's standout feature is its ability to capture a freeze-frame from an uploaded video, turning a fleeting moment into the perfect, high-impact thumbnail base.

This video-first workflow makes Kapwing one of the best thumbnail makers for YouTube channels that rely on in-video action shots, tutorials, or dynamic moments. Instead of taking separate photos, you can simply pull the most compelling frame and enhance it directly within the browser-based editor. The collaborative tools, like shared workspaces, also make it a strong choice for creative teams or channels with multiple contributors.

Kapwing

Key Features & Pricing

  • Freeze-Frame Capture: Easily grab a high-resolution still image from any point in your video to use as a thumbnail background.
  • Collaborative Workspaces: Invite team members to edit, comment, and work on thumbnail designs together in a shared project space.
  • Full Video Suite: The thumbnail maker is part of a larger video editing suite, allowing for a seamless workflow from editing to promotion.
  • Stock Assets & Templates: Access a library of templates, stock photos, and elements to decorate your captured frames.

Pricing: Kapwing has a free plan that includes a watermark on exported projects. The Pro plan starts at $24/month ($16/month when billed annually) and removes the watermark, unlocks higher export quality, and provides more cloud storage.

Feature Free Plan Pro Plan
Watermark Yes, on all exports No watermark
Export Quality Up to 720p Up to 4K resolution
Project Storage Limited, with auto-deletion of old projects Unlimited project storage
AI Tools Credits Limited starter credits Monthly credits for AI features

Pros:

  • Excellent workflow for creating thumbnails directly from video content.
  • Strong collaborative features are ideal for teams.
  • Completely browser-based, requiring no software installation.

Cons:

  • The free plan’s watermark is a significant drawback for professional use.
  • Advanced AI features are credit-based, even on paid tiers.

12. TubeBuddy

TubeBuddy is more than just a design tool; it’s a comprehensive YouTube optimization suite that lives directly inside your YouTube Studio. Its integrated Thumbnail Generator is designed for creators who want to streamline their workflow by combining design, SEO, and analytics in one place. Instead of switching between tabs, you can create a thumbnail, optimize your title, and check your video’s performance without leaving the platform where you publish.

This integration is TubeBuddy's killer feature. It allows you to use a still frame from your uploaded video as a background, then add text, graphics, and branding elements on top. This makes it an incredibly efficient and one of the best thumbnail makers for YouTube if your goal is to pair visual design with data-driven optimization, including the ability to A/B test your designs to see what performs best with your audience.

TubeBuddy

Key Features & Pricing

  • Integrated Thumbnail Generator: Create and edit thumbnails directly within the YouTube upload screen.
  • A/B Testing: (Legend plan) Test different thumbnails to see which one earns more clicks.
  • Template Creation: Save your thumbnail designs as templates for quick reuse and brand consistency.
  • SEO & Keyword Tools: Comes bundled with a powerful suite of tools for title, description, and tag optimization.

Pricing: TubeBuddy offers a free plan with limited features. The Pro plan starts at $4.49/month, with the Legend plan (which includes A/B testing) at $20.99/month.

Feature Free Plan Pro Plan ($4.49/mo) Legend Plan ($20.99/mo)
Thumbnail Generator Limited Yes Yes
Thumbnail Templates No Yes Yes
A/B Testing No No Yes
SEO Studio Limited Yes Yes

Pros:

  • Extremely convenient workflow inside YouTube Studio.
  • Pairs thumbnail creation directly with powerful A/B testing and analytics.
  • Excellent for creators focused on data-driven optimization.

Cons:

  • The design tool itself is more basic compared to dedicated platforms like Canva or PhotoAI Studio.
  • The most valuable features, like A/B testing, are locked behind the most expensive plan.

How do I make a good YouTube thumbnail? A good thumbnail should be clear, high-contrast, and emotionally engaging. It needs to accurately represent the video's content while creating curiosity. Key elements include a high-quality image (often a person's face with a clear expression), bold and easy-to-read text (3-5 words max), and strong branding (consistent colors and fonts).
